Abstract :
The thermally stimulated current (T.S.C.) diagrams have been recorded above 0°C, with samples obtained by pelleting under a pressure of 3.5 T/cm2, the PVC powder. These T.S.C diagrams, obtained with conditions of polarization Tp=125°C, tp=2 min., Fp=3.105 V/m, have shown at 80°C. In the neighbourhood of the glass transition, a first peak with a shoulder towards 55°C. A second peak, associated to a liquid-liquid transition appears at 123°C. The ratio Tll(°K)/Tg(°K)=1.13 is close to those obtained with different polymers by different authors. The Tll follows a Vogel-W.L.F. law τ=τ0exp(αr(T-∞))-1 where T=304°K
